WebPurpose: To investigate the optimal starting points for drilling on the lateral femoral condyle for better coverage of the anatomical footprint of the anterior cruciate ligament (ACL) … WebNov 20, 2024 · Plain radiographs remain the mainstay of diagnosis and characterization of distal femoral fractures. However, CT is often helpful, since most distal femoral fractures are intra-articular 1. MRI can be helpful if concomitant meniscal tears or a ligamentous injury is suspected 3. Fractures will usually show a radiolucency or cortical breach.

Fig. … WebThe femoral condyles form the trochlear groove that provides the articulating surface of the femur. Similar to the articular surface of the patella, the trochlear surface is divided into medial and lateral facets, the lateral facet being larger and extending more proximally and anteriorly than its medial counterpart (Figure 22-2 ).
